When the micturition reflex is initiated, the brain responds by __________ action potentials (aps) in somatic motor neurons, res

ulting in the relaxation of the __________ urinary sphincter so urine can be voided?
Biology
2 answers:
Paladinen [302]3 years ago
7 0

When the micturition reflex is initiated, the brain responds by decreasing action potentials (aps) in somatic motor neurons, resulting in the relaxation of the external urinary sphincter so urine can be voided.

What is the source of energy that powers a hydroelectric power plant?
Verdich [7]

Answer:  Given your four choices, the best/most correct one would be (c) the sunlight that evaporated water that eventually falls as rain and fills the reservoir. It is the potential energy stored in the reservoir water which is "released" as it is converted to kinetic energy (the movement of water which spins the hydroelectric generator turbine, etc.), but the absolute source of that original potential energy comes from the Sun's action to evaporate lake or ocean water which is returned to Earth as rain ... and it is this rainwater which ultimately fills the reservoir behind the hydroelectric power plant.
